菜谱大全

菜谱大全

专用API
服务商 服务商: RollToolsApi
【更新时间: 2024.03.18】 菜谱大全 API 服务,能够进行菜谱信息的查询,方便快捷地获取各类菜谱详情。同时还支持添加评论信息,这使其不仅可单纯用于查询,还能满足用户互动交流的需求,非常适合在各种菜谱应用中发挥作用。
免费 (无限制) 去服务商官网采购>
服务星级:6星
⭐ ⭐ ⭐ ⭐ ⭐ ⭐ 🌟
调用次数
0
集成人数
0
商用人数
0
! SLA: N/A
! 响应: N/A
! 适用于个人&企业
收藏
×
完成
取消
×
书签名称
确定
<
产品介绍
>

什么是菜谱大全?

菜谱大全API是由RoolToolsApi提供的接口服务,旨在为开发者提供丰富的菜谱信息,以便在各种应用程序中使用。该API允许用户通过关键词搜索来获取菜谱的详细信息,包括名称、所需材料、描述和封面图片等。

什么是菜谱大全?

由服务使用方的应用程序发起,以Restful风格为主、通过公网HTTP协议调用菜谱大全,从而实现程序的自动化交互,提高服务效率。
<
使用指南
>

申请RollToolsApi

  • 申请app_id的方式已经更改,现在需要通过小程序申请。RollToolsApi,开放易用的接口服务
  • 用户需要登录小程序,绑定手机号,并从【通用ROLLAPI】公众号获取平台验证码来完成绑定。
  • 绑定成功后,用户可以通过观看广告或直接通过公众号获取app_id。

使用RollToolsApi

  • RollToolsApi的使用需要app_id和app_secret,这两个参数作为身份验证,用于调用接口。
  • 用户可以通过在请求链接后添加参数或在请求头中添加来使用接口。
  • 正确接入后,用户可以在小程序中查看接口调用情况,并在官网注册账号以查看请求量数据。

特权申请

  • 学生和老师可以申请账号特权,享受更高会员等级的请求体验。
  • 申请特权的方式是通过扫描客服二维码或添加客服微信
<
关于我们
>
RollToolsApi公司是一家提供API服务的科技公司,专注于为开发者和企业提供高效、可靠的API解决方案。公司通过其API平台,帮助用户轻松实现数据的获取、处理和分析,从而提高开发效率和业务决策能力。RollToolsApi致力于构建一个开放、共享的技术生态,推动技术创新和行业发展。
联系信息
服务时间: 0:00:00至24:00:00
邮箱: mxnzp_life@163.com
QQ: 792075058
微信二维码:
查看
×
<
最可能同场景使用的其他API
>
API接口列表
用关键字搜索菜谱信息
获取食谱分类信息
根据菜谱分类id获取菜谱列表
获取菜谱详细信息
添加菜谱的评论信息
获取菜谱对应的评论信息
用关键字搜索菜谱信息
1.1 简要描述
用关键字搜索菜谱信息
1.2 请求URL
https://www.mxnzp.com/api/cookbook/search
1.3 请求方式
GET
1.4 入参
参数名 参数类型 默认值 是否必传 描述
keyword String 菜谱关键字
page String 搜索的页码
1.5 出参
参数名 参数类型 默认值 描述
id String 菜谱id
name String 菜谱名称
desc String 菜谱描述信息
ingredient Array 菜谱所需材料
ingredient-name String 材料名称
cover String 菜谱封面
1.6 错误码
错误码 错误信息 描述
1.7 示例
{
    "code": 1,
    "msg": "数据返回成功!",
    "data": {
        "page": 1,
        "totalCount": 2082,
        "totalPage": 209,
        "limit": 10,
        "list": [
            {
                "id": 322605,
                "name": "酸辣汤",
                "desc": "",
                "ingredient": [
                    {
                        "name": "鸡蛋"
                    },
                    {
                        "name": "番茄?"
                    },
                    {
                        "name": "金针菇"
                    },
                    {
                        "name": "胡萝卜丝"
                    },
                    {
                        "name": "火腿肠丝"
                    },
                    {
                        "name": "木耳"
                    },
                    {
                        "name": "香菜"
                    },
                    {
                        "name": "豆腐皮"
                    },
                    {
                        "name": "淀粉"
                    },
                    {
                        "name": "白胡椒粉"
                    },
                    {
                        "name": "盐"
                    },
                    {
                        "name": "醋"
                    }
                ],
                "cover": "http://power-api.cretinzp.com:8000/cookbook_file/1/f/6/d/7/f/b/c/d25f72b748684af2b328d4e9433c8d38.jpg"
            },
            ...这里只显示一条数据
        ]
    }
}
获取食谱分类信息
2.1 简要描述
获取食谱分类信息
2.2 请求URL
https://www.mxnzp.com/api/cookbook/category
2.3 请求方式
GET
2.4 入参
参数名 参数类型 默认值 是否必传 描述
category_id String 分类id,一级大分类请传-1或者不传
2.5 出参
参数名 参数类型 默认值 描述
id String 分类id
name String 分类名称
floor String 分类层级
2.6 错误码
错误码 错误信息 描述
2.7 示例
{
    "code": 1,
    "msg": "数据返回成功!",
    "data": [
        {
            "id": 1,
            "name": "热门专题",
            "floor": 1
        },
        {
            "id": 44,
            "name": "烘焙甜品饮料",
            "floor": 1
        },
        {
            "id": 69,
            "name": "肉类",
            "floor": 1
        }
	...这里只显示三条
    ]
}
根据菜谱分类id获取菜谱列表
3.1 简要描述
根据菜谱分类id获取菜谱列表
3.2 请求URL
https://www.mxnzp.com/api/cookbook/list/category
3.3 请求方式
GET
3.4 入参
参数名 参数类型 默认值 是否必传 描述
category_id String 分类id,请使用三级分类id进行数据获取
page String 分页
3.5 出参
参数名 参数类型 默认值 描述
id String 菜谱id
name String 菜谱名称
desc String 菜谱描述信息
ingredient Array 菜谱所需材料
ingredient-name String 材料名称
cover String 菜谱封面
3.6 错误码
错误码 错误信息 描述
3.7 示例
{
    "code": 1,
    "msg": "数据返回成功!",
    "data": {
        "page": 1,
        "totalCount": 44620,
        "totalPage": 4462,
        "limit": 10,
        "list": [
            {
                "id": 100086,
                "name": "干锅花菜",
                "desc": "",
                "ingredient": [
                    {
                        "name": "花菜"
                    },
                    {
                        "name": "干辣椒"
                    },
                    {
                        "name": "五花肉"
                    },
                    {
                        "name": "生抽"
                    },
                    {
                        "name": "盐"
                    },
                    {
                        "name": "鸡精"
                    },
                    {
                        "name": "豆瓣酱"
                    },
                    {
                        "name": "蚝油"
                    },
                    {
                        "name": "蒸鱼豉油"
                    },
                    {
                        "name": "韭菜"
                    },
                    {
                        "name": "孜然粉"
                    }
                ],
                "cover": "http://power-api.cretinzp.com:8000/cookbook_file/6/b/8/d/3/3/7/c/26f89936c833479398ec7132db8ce7c0.jpg"
            },
            ...这里只显示一条数据
        ]
    }
}
获取菜谱详细信息
4.1 简要描述
获取菜谱详细信息
4.2 请求URL
https://www.mxnzp.com/api/cookbook/details
4.3 请求方式
GET
4.4 入参
参数名 参数类型 默认值 是否必传 描述
id String 菜谱id
4.5 出参
参数名 参数类型 默认值 描述
id String 菜谱id
name String 分类名称
tips String 小提示信息
difficulty String 菜谱制作难易度
duration String 制作时间
commentCount String 评论数量
ingredient Array 菜谱材料信息
ingredient-name String 材料名称
ingredient-amount String 材料规格
instruction Array 操作步骤
instruction-text String 步骤内容
instruction-url String 步骤图片链接
instruction-step String 步骤数
4.6 错误码
错误码 错误信息 描述
4.7 示例
{
    "code": 1,
    "msg": "数据返回成功!",
    "data": {
        "id": 100086,
        "name": "干锅花菜",
        "tips": "辣度根据个人口味。怕辣就不要放干辣椒哦",
        "difficulty": "容易做",
        "instruction": [
            {
                "text": "准备一颗花菜洗净,切掉根部 ",
                "url": "http://power-api.cretinzp.com:8000/cookbook_file/8/3/0/0/9/2/2/ed1649e322b840629f243c4065cb41a5.jpg",
                "step": "第1步"
            },
            {
                "text": "准备一个小碗。分别倒入一勺豆瓣酱,一勺蚝油,一勺生抽,半勺蒸鱼豉油,再加入一点鸡精。搅匀备用。",
                "url": "http://power-api.cretinzp.com:8000/cookbook_file/b/0/a/6/9/f/4/5/6e6f3e6874fe43ed901a3bf34a9a854d.jpg",
                "step": "第2步"
            },
            {
                "text": "锅中倒入五花肉,慢慢煸炒炒出油脂出来。",
                "url": "http://power-api.cretinzp.com:8000/cookbook_file/7/0/f/5/c/7/b/4/cc811a91a7454ec8b40c4ba89a5346f7.jpg",
                "step": "第3步"
            },
            {
                "text": "再倒入干辣椒和蒜末 炒出香味",
                "url": "http://power-api.cretinzp.com:8000/cookbook_file/4/a/4/9/3/4/0/6/02e9a7ddb3ad4d83b0e951b0e2df5fea.jpg",
                "step": "第4步"
            },
            {
                "text": "最后倒入花菜和刚刚调好的料汁继续翻炒至花菜炒熟。中间如果干了可以少量多次加适量水。",
                "url": "http://power-api.cretinzp.com:8000/cookbook_file/d/d/1/a/1/c/e/a/d818bfd4e6ac406986fbdda77dfc2592.jpg",
                "step": "第5步"
            },
            {
                "text": "快熟时加入点韭菜或者大蒜叶都可以。然后撒点孜然粉和适量盐 翻炒后就可以出锅啦。",
                "url": "http://power-api.cretinzp.com:8000/cookbook_file/8/8/7/d/8/f/e/4/0a22d51249af412abdf8442e6e7912fe.jpg",
                "step": "第6步"
            }
        ],
        "duration": "15分钟左右",
        "commentCount": 0,
        "ingredient": [
            {
                "name": "花菜",
                "amount": "半个"
            },
            {
                "name": "干辣椒",
                "amount": "4-6个"
            },
            {
                "name": "五花肉",
                "amount": "200克"
            },
            {
                "name": "生抽",
                "amount": "1勺"
            },
            {
                "name": "盐",
                "amount": "适量"
            },
            {
                "name": "鸡精",
                "amount": "四分之一勺"
            },
            {
                "name": "豆瓣酱",
                "amount": "1勺"
            },
            {
                "name": "蚝油",
                "amount": "1勺"
            },
            {
                "name": "蒸鱼豉油",
                "amount": "半勺"
            },
            {
                "name": "韭菜",
                "amount": "100克"
            },
            {
                "name": "孜然粉",
                "amount": "三分之一勺"
            }
        ]
    }
}
添加菜谱的评论信息
5.1 简要描述
添加菜谱对应的评论信息
5.2 请求URL
https://www.mxnzp.com/api/cookbook/comment/add
5.3 请求方式
GET
5.4 入参
参数名 参数类型 默认值 是否必传 描述
id String 菜谱id
name String 评论名称,这个需要你自己发挥想象,建议按照设备或者你有用户系统的时候生成一个当前的用户名
content String 评论内容,最多255字符
5.5 出参
参数名 参数类型 默认值 描述
5.6 错误码
错误码 错误信息 描述
5.7 示例
{
    "code": 1,
    "msg": "数据返回成功!"
}
获取菜谱对应的评论信息
6.1 简要描述
获取菜谱对应的评论信息
6.2 请求URL
https://www.mxnzp.com/api/cookbook/comment/list
6.3 请求方式
GET
6.4 入参
参数名 参数类型 默认值 是否必传 描述
id String 菜谱id
name String 评论名称,这个需要你自己发挥想象,建议按照设备或者你有用户系统的时候生成一个当前的用户名
content String 评论内容,最多255字符
6.5 出参
参数名 参数类型 默认值 描述
id String 评论id
name String 评论名称
content String 评论信息
time String 评论时间
6.6 错误码
错误码 错误信息 描述
6.7 示例
{
    "code": 1,
    "msg": "数据返回成功!",
    "data": {
        "page": 1,
        "totalCount": 1,
        "totalPage": 1,
        "limit": 10,
        "list": [
            {
                "id": 4,
                "name": "大哥大",
                "content": "我是评论信息",
                "time": "2023-10-12 23:33:17"
            }
        ]
    }
}
<
使用指南
>

申请RollToolsApi

  • 申请app_id的方式已经更改,现在需要通过小程序申请。RollToolsApi,开放易用的接口服务
  • 用户需要登录小程序,绑定手机号,并从【通用ROLLAPI】公众号获取平台验证码来完成绑定。
  • 绑定成功后,用户可以通过观看广告或直接通过公众号获取app_id。

使用RollToolsApi

  • RollToolsApi的使用需要app_id和app_secret,这两个参数作为身份验证,用于调用接口。
  • 用户可以通过在请求链接后添加参数或在请求头中添加来使用接口。
  • 正确接入后,用户可以在小程序中查看接口调用情况,并在官网注册账号以查看请求量数据。

特权申请

  • 学生和老师可以申请账号特权,享受更高会员等级的请求体验。
  • 申请特权的方式是通过扫描客服二维码或添加客服微信
<
依赖服务
>
<
关于我们
>
RollToolsApi公司是一家提供API服务的科技公司,专注于为开发者和企业提供高效、可靠的API解决方案。公司通过其API平台,帮助用户轻松实现数据的获取、处理和分析,从而提高开发效率和业务决策能力。RollToolsApi致力于构建一个开放、共享的技术生态,推动技术创新和行业发展。
联系信息
服务时间: 0:00:00至24:00:00
邮箱: mxnzp_life@163.com
QQ: 792075058
微信二维码:
查看
×
<
最可能同场景使用的其他API
>